141      - start to use DIAGNOSTICS_ADDTOLIST (necessary for diagnostics with
142        a counter mate) in pkg diagnostics, ptracers, thsice & aim_v23.
143    o add parameter rotateGrid and Euler angles EulerPhi/Theta/Psi. For
144      usingSphericalGrid, this allows to define the rotated grid coordinates
145      via phiMin/thetaMin/dxSpacing/dySpacing, etc., but then re-compute the
146      geographical coordinates according to the inverse of the rotation defined
147      by the Euler angles, so that Coriolis parameter and online-interpolation by
148      exf works with the geographical coordinates on XC/YC/XG/YG.
149      Naturally, this feature does not work with all packages, so some
150      combinations are prohibited in config_summary (flt, flt_zonal, ecco,
151      profiles), because there the coordinates are assumed to be regular
152      spherical grid coordinates.
